The functional core of this method is the Request for Quote, or RFQ, system. An RFQ is a formal, private inquiry sent to a curated network of institutional market makers. Within this inquiry, you define the exact parameters of your desired trade ▴ the instrument, the size, the structure, whether it is a single-leg option or a complex multi-part strategy. In response, these liquidity providers compete, returning a firm, executable price available for a specific window of time.

This process fundamentally reorients the trading dynamic. You are initiating a competitive auction for your order flow, compelling the market’s largest players to provide their sharpest price for your specific size. The procedure grants anonymity, shielding your intentions from the broader market and preventing the price impact that often accompanies large orders placed on a public exchange.

The digital asset landscape is inherently fragmented, with liquidity spread across numerous venues and instruments. Attempting to execute a significant or multi-legged options strategy through a public order book is an exercise in cost-inefficiency. You contend with slippage, where the price moves against you as your order consumes available liquidity.

You face leg risk, the danger that the price of one part of your strategy will shift while you are trying to execute another. The RFQ process mitigates these inherent frictions. It consolidates the fragmented liquidity pool into a single point of contact, delivering a unified, executable price for your entire intended structure. Executing Volatility Positions with Confidence

Trading volatility is a primary expression of a sophisticated market view, yet it is notoriously difficult to execute cleanly. Strategies like straddles (buying a call and a put at the same strike) or strangles (buying an out-of-the-money call and put) require two separate transactions. Executing these on a public exchange introduces uncertainty. The time between the two fills can see the market move, degrading the entry price of the combined position.

An RFQ for a BTC or ETH straddle collapses this two-part problem into a single event. You specify the entire structure ▴ the asset, the expiration, the strike, and the total size ▴ in one request. The responding market makers provide a single price for the entire package. Your execution is atomic; both legs are filled simultaneously at the quoted price.

This provides an immutable cost basis for the position, allowing you to manage the trade based on its strategic merit, with full confidence that the entry was as efficient as possible. The same principle applies to more directional volatility plays, such as risk reversals or put spreads, where the cost of the structure is the critical variable for success.

Constructing Defensive Structures at Scale

Protecting a large spot portfolio is a constant strategic imperative. A common defensive structure is the collar, which involves holding the underlying asset, selling an out-of-the-money call option, and using the premium from that sale to finance the purchase of a protective put option. The goal is to establish a floor for the portfolio’s value while capping its potential upside, often for a zero or near-zero net cost. Executing a large collar via the public order book is fraught with risk.

The size of the options required can alert the market to your hedging activity, potentially causing adverse price movements in both the options and the underlying asset. The Smart Trade Method using an RFQ provides a confidential and efficient alternative. A trader can request a quote for the entire collar structure as a single package. Liquidity providers will compete to offer the best net price for the combined options legs, allowing the trader to implement a portfolio-scale hedge in one private, instantaneous transaction. This ensures the defensive posture is established at a known cost, without disturbing the market you are seeking to protect yourself from.

A multi-maker quote system, central to advanced RFQ platforms, can execute at the last matched price for an entire block, ensuring that even pooled liquidity results in a single, predictable execution cost for the taker.

The Mechanics of a Smart Trade

Deploying capital through an RFQ system follows a logical and repeatable sequence. Mastering this process is essential for consistently achieving optimal execution. The workflow is designed for clarity and control, placing the trader in a position of authority over the transaction.

  1. Strategy Formulation The process begins with a clear investment thesis. You must define the exact structure you intend to trade. This includes the underlying asset (e.g. BTC), the instrument type (e.g. European Option), the specific legs of the trade (e.g. selling one 50000 Call, buying one 45000 Put), the expiration date, and the total notional size of the position.
  2. Quote Request Initiation With the trade parameters defined, you submit the RFQ to the platform’s network of liquidity providers. This is done privately. The market makers see the components of the requested trade but do not see your identity or your directional bias (buy or sell). This anonymity is a critical component of the system’s value.
  3. Competitive Quoting Period Upon receiving the request, the market makers have a set period, often just a few minutes, to analyze the trade and respond with their best bid and offer prices. They are competing against each other, which creates a powerful incentive for them to provide the tightest possible spread for your requested size.
  4. Quote Evaluation and Execution The system aggregates the responses and presents you with the best available bid and ask price. You now have a firm, executable quote for your entire trade structure. You can choose to execute on either side of the quote or let the request expire if no price is satisfactory. A single click executes the entire block trade, which is then settled directly into your account.
  5. Post-Trade Confirmation The trade is confirmed and settled instantly. The position appears in your portfolio with a clear, unified cost basis, free from the ambiguity of multiple fills and uncertain slippage costs. The entire operation, from request to settlement, is a contained, efficient, and professional transaction.

A Comparative Execution Analysis

The value of the RFQ method becomes tangible when compared to standard market execution for a significant trade. The reduction of market impact is a direct and quantifiable improvement to the trader’s profit and loss statement. Consider the following hypothetical scenario for a large options purchase.

Parameter Public Market Order Execution RFQ Block Trade Execution
Trade Requirement Buy 100 Contracts of BTC $70,000 Call Buy 100 Contracts of BTC $70,000 Call
Top-of-Book Price $1,500 N/A (Price is negotiated)
Order Book Depth 20 contracts @ $1,500; 30 @ $1,510; 50 @ $1,525 Deep institutional liquidity pool
Execution Process Order sweeps multiple price levels Single, firm quote is provided
Average Fill Price $1,514.50 $1,505 (Negotiated competitive price)
Total Slippage Cost $1,450 ((1514.50 – 1500) 100) $0 (vs. the firm quote)
Market Impact High. Signals large buying interest. Minimal. Trade is private.

This analysis demonstrates the economic benefit of the Smart Trade Method. The trader using the RFQ system achieves a superior average price and avoids broadcasting their intentions to the wider market, preserving the integrity of their strategy. Unlocking Complex Relative Value Trades

The most sophisticated trading strategies often involve relative value propositions ▴ positions designed to profit from pricing discrepancies between related instruments. These can include calendar spreads (trading options of different expirations), butterfly spreads (pinning a specific price point), or volatility arbitrage strategies across different assets. These structures can have four or more individual legs. Attempting to piece together such a trade on a public exchange is a high-risk endeavor.

The probability of achieving a poor fill on one or more legs is extremely high, potentially invalidating the entire premise of the trade. The RFQ system is purpose-built for this kind of complexity. It allows a trader to bundle an entire multi-leg structure into a single request. Market makers who specialize in these complex derivatives can price the entire package as a single unit, managing their own internal risks to provide one competitive, executable quote.

Order Book

Meaning ▴ An Order Book is a real-time electronic ledger detailing all outstanding buy and sell orders for a specific financial instrument, organized by price level and sorted by time priority within each level.

Rfq System

Meaning ▴ An RFQ System, or Request for Quote System, is a dedicated electronic platform designed to facilitate the solicitation of executable prices from multiple liquidity providers for a specified financial instrument and quantity.
